The Turkish defense industry, with the projects it has undertaken in recent years, is not only updating its inventory but also making moves that will change military doctrines on a regional and global scale. One of the most notable of these moves is undoubtedly the TAYFUN project, which is Türkiye's first Short-Range Ballistic Missile (SRBM). The recent successful test launch, announced by the President of the Presidency of Defense Industries, Prof. Dr. Haluk Görgün, demonstrates that another critical threshold has been crossed in the development process of TAYFUN and that the project is rapidly progressing towards operational maturity.
TAYFUN Project: Transition from Tactical Field to Strategic Dimension
Turkey has accumulated significant expertise in artillery rockets and tactical missiles (such as BORA/KHAN) over many years. However, the TAYFUN project is taking Türkiye to a different league in ballistic missile technology. Having achieved precision strike capability in the 280-kilometer range with the BORA missile, the Turkish Armed Forces are expanding this range with TAYFUN, gaining "deep strike" capability.
Why is this capacity increase important?
In the modern battlefield, the ability to strike enemy logistics centers, command and control buildings, air bases, and critical infrastructure far behind the front lines is the most crucial factor determining the fate of the war. TAYFUN offers Türkiye the capability to destroy these targets with conventional warheads, high precision, and at an unstoppable speed. The missile's ability to exit and re-enter the atmosphere to target creates an extremely difficult threat profile for existing air defense systems to counter.
